Position:
Individual Support Specialist - Site Based

Block Institute is seeking an experienced and dedicated Individual Support Specialist to join our Adult Day Services team.

In this role, you will collaborate with the interdisciplinary team to develop and implement day program plans based on person-centered practices.

You'll be responsible for managing electronic case records through THERAP and ensuring the success and well-being of individuals in the program.

If you're passionate about helping individuals with developmental disabilities achieve their personal goals and maximum levels of independence, this role is for you


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ities:


  • Maintain and review electronic case records, ensuring compliance with Block Institute's policies and protocols.
  • Develop individual program plans, including assessment, development, implementation, and monitoring of training programs.
  • Create and update Day Hab Staff Action Plans semiannually, and as necessary.
  • Conduct semiannual Life Planning Team meetings and ensure thorough documentation of goals, outcomes, and program adjustments.
  • Train Direct Support Professionals (DSPs) on the implementation of services and support to ensure compliance with all OPWDD regulations and Block Institute's standards.
  • Collaborate with the Enrollment and Compliance Coordinator to ensure billing documentation corresponds with services listed on the Day Habilitation Staff Action Plan.
  • Prepare monthly progress notes and submit billing documentation to the finance department.
  • Monitor progress toward individual goals and update staff action plans as needed.
  • Ensure the health, safety, comfort, and wellbeing of program participants at all times.
  • Maintain confidentiality of program participants and follow Block Institute's policies on reporting incidents, including abuse and neglect.
  • Use positive approaches in difficult situations and demonstrate flexibility and adaptability to change.
  • Adhere to the Justice Center Code of Conduct and Block Institute's policies, including attendance and punctuality.
  • Represent Block Institute in a professional manner, upholding the agency's mission, vision, and values.

Qualifications:


  • Bachelor's degree in health, human services, or special education. Master's degree preferred.
  • Minimum three years' experience working with individuals with intellectual disabilities.
  • Supervisory and training experience preferred.
  • Working knowledge of NYS OPWDD Day program regulations.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Word, Excel, and Therap software.
  • Training in the Council for Quality Leadership's Personal Outcome Measures evaluation tool preferred.
